MEMPHIS, TN (abc24.com) - Memphis police have arrested two teen boys for beating and robbing a man at a Raleigh area apartment complex.

The robbery occurred just after midnight on Tuesday, June 19 at the Raleigh Village Apartments on Yale at Covington Pike. Investigators say a 48-year-old man was walking in the complex when two male suspects beat him with a bottle and took cash from his pockets, then ran away.

The suspects had followed the victim from a nearby gas station and were seen on surveillance video just before the robbery. Another officer recognized the suspects and took them into custody.

Police arrested 15-year-old Tyreese Manuel and 17-year-old Devon Shead and charged both teens with Aggravated Robbery.
